Difference of Chuanxiong Rhizoma from Different Regions Based on Multiple Wavelength Coverage Fusion Fingerprint
Objective: To set up the multi-wavelength fusion UPLC fingerprint of 10 batches of Chuanxiong Rhizoma from different regions
initially identify common peaks
and compare the Chuanxiong Rhizoma from different regions through fingerprints
and provide the basis for its quality control and medicinal material identification. Method: UPLC was used to set up the multi-wavelength fingerprints of Chuanxiong Rhizoma from different regions. SPSS 19.0 data statistics software was used to analyze the differences of Chuanxiong Rhizoma in different regions
and full time multiple wave length fusion technology was used for multiple wavelength fusion of dif date. Q-TOF method was used to identify the common peaks in fingerprints. Result: Fingerprints of multi-wavelength fusion of Chuanxiong Rhizoma were established;20 common peaks were determined and 8 peaks of them were identified. By clustering analysis and similarity evaluation
it was found that Yunnan Chuanxiong Rhizoma had certain difference with other regions. Conclusion: The fingerprints were reproducible and can be able to distinguish the Chuanxiong Rhizoma from different regions. This method can be applied for quality control of Chuanxiong Rhizoma.
